

In the late 1800s, Abby Walker, an affluent and tough-minded Bostonian, embarks on a journey out west with her husband Liam. After crossing paths with Calian, a curious Apache tracker, Abby arrives in the town of Independence, Texas, where she encounters diverse and eclectic residents running from their pasts, chasing their dreams, and keeping their own secrets, including Kate Carver, an idiosyncratic burlesque dancer with perhaps too keen an interest in Abby's origins, and Kai, a soulful Chinese immigrant who runs a local restaurant/laundry and offers Abby friendship without agenda.

Abby is joined by rough and tumble outlaw Hoyt and Apache scout, Calian, when she revisits the tragic site of her life's demise in search of clues to help uncover the cold-blooded killer hiding in town. Meanwhile, new Sheriff Tom Davidson, and the town's loyal Deputy, Gus, are determined to track down the "mysterious" man responsible for the recent bank robbery. Kate badgers Hagan into doing the right thing, and Lucia finds a new friend - and discovers a surprising talent - in Kai.
